Edible Flakes Market Value Growth And Long-Term Outlook
The edible flakes market size has seen substantial growth recently. It is anticipated to expand from $25.39 billion in 2025 to $27.18 billion in 2026, registering a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.0%. Historically, this growth has been fueled by factors such as an increase in packaged breakfast consumption, the proliferation of urban lifestyles, a heightened demand for convenient nutrition, the widespread availability of large-scale cereal processing, and the growing retail presence of breakfast products.
The edible flakes market size is projected to experience robust expansion over the upcoming years. This market is anticipated to reach a valuation of $37.06 billion by 2030, demonstrating a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.1%. Factors contributing to this expansion during the forecast timeframe include a growing appetite for cereals rich in protein and low in sugar, an escalating emphasis on the sustainable procurement of grains, the proliferation of online grocery platforms, the increasing appeal of plant-derived breakfast choices, and enhanced creativity in cereal product development. Key trends anticipated over this period encompass a surge in the consumption of organic and whole-grain cereals, the introduction of more fortified and functional flake varieties, a rising inclination towards breakfast items with clean labels, a heightened concentration on achieving optimal texture and crispness, and the development of new products incorporating alternative grains.

Edible Flakes Market Demand Drivers Opening New Revenue Streams
The increasing number of vegan consumers is projected to stimulate the growth of the edible flakes market moving forward. Vegan consumers are individuals who adhere to a plant-based lifestyle, completely avoiding animal-derived products. The escalation in veganism is fueled by elements such as growing health awareness, ethical considerations, and environmental sustainability, which encourages more people to select plant-based food alternatives. Edible flakes align well with vegan dietary preferences, as they are plant-based and provide convenient, nutritious, and flavorful additions to various meals. For instance, in April 2024, according to Finder, a US-based personal finance comparison site, approximately 2.5 million individuals in the UK were vegan in 2024, representing 4.7% of the population, an increase from 1.4 million vegans (2.5%) in 2023, reflecting an increase of 1.1 million within a year. Hence, the expanding base of vegan consumers is propelling the growth of the edible flakes market.
Edible Flakes Market Segment Performance And Emerging Opportunities
The edible flakes market covered in this report is segmented –
1) By Product: Wheat Flakes, Rice Flakes, Flakey Oats, Corn Flakes, Other Products
2) By Nature: Organic, Conventional
3) By Distribution Channel: Hypermarkets Or Supermarkets, Online Retailers, Specialty Stores
Subsegments:
1) By Wheat Flakes: Whole Wheat Flakes, Multigrain Wheat Flakes
2) By Rice Flakes: Flattened Rice, Puffed Rice Flakes
3) By Flakey Oats: Instant Oats Flakes, Rolled Oats Flakes
4) By Corn Flakes: Sweetened Corn Flakes, Unsweetened Corn Flakes
5) By Other Products: Barley Flakes, Quinoa Flakes, Millet Flakes
Edible Flakes Market Trends Powering Strategic Industry Growth
Leading companies operating in the edible flakes market are concentrating on crafting salted caramel flakes to enhance their market profitability. Salted caramel edible flakes are characterized as thin, flat food items made with a combination of salted caramel taste and a flaky or crispy texture. For instance, in October 2023, Stover & Company, a US-based supplier of baking products, launched salted Caramel flakes through its Eleven o’one brand. These tiny and crisp Salted Caramel Flakes introduce an innovative flavor dimension to culinary creations. The product exhibits remarkable versatility, elevating the taste of treats like ice cream, cupcakes, and brownies. Baked goods can be enriched by incorporating these delightful flakes into cookie, muffin, or cake batter, resulting in an eruption of salted caramel flavor that will leave everyone desiring the secret recipe.

Edible Flakes Market Regional Analysis: Which Geography Leads On Revenue?
North America was the largest region in the edible flakes market in 2025.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period. The regions covered in the edible flakes market report are Asia-Pacific, South East Asia, Western Europe, Eastern Europe, North America, South America, Middle East and Africa.
